Where does the Power of the Anointed Come from?
by Stephen Piperno

Posted: 18:00 December 23, 2006


In every religion, healers and miracle workers always stand out amongst the congregation. Most religions testify about the power of their ancient and modern day miracle workers. These men and women are said to be able to perform miracles such as: healing the sick, casting out evil entities and being able to put the power of God over you in such a way that you may even fall to the floor. The question here is, why do these powerful men and women stand out amongst the rest and why have they been chosen to be blessed with such power?

Let us first look at Pastor Benny Hinn. Pastor Benny Hinn is a Christian Pastor and the founder of Benny Hinn Ministries. He began his ministry as a young man many years ago. He presently travels all over the world hosting spiritual crusades. Many evangelical Christians consider him to be a healer and an anointed man of God. Benny Hinn considers himself to be a born again Christian and chosen by God to heal, preach and conduct spiritual crusades throughout the world. His television show, ?This is Your Day? is watched daily by millions of Christians worldwide. Pastor Benny Hinn is also the author of the book, ?Good Morning Holy Spirit.

In several of Benny Hinn?s crusades, he often raises his hand and says, ?I feel the anointing coming on. When he believes this, he says, ?take the anointing? and he drops his hand down in a downward movement quickly. The crusade attendees often fall down, shake all over and sometimes go into a temporary sleep or trans-like state.

Benny Hinn?s followers believe that he is a man of God and he has the ?anointed power through Jesus Christ? to cast out demons, heal the sick and preach the gospel of Jesus Christ. People at Benny Hinn?s crusades claim that when they attended the crusade, they were healed of: cancer, heart disease, diabetes and even being able to walk out of a wheel chair.

Although Benny Hinn teaches that this power comes from Jesus Christ and not himself, he seems to be the star at his crusades. Benny Hinn claims that all Christians have this authority to do what he does. However, Christians and non-Christians seem to flock to his crusades by the thousands. They wait on long lines outside of the places where he holds his massive crusades. The Christians on the line outside of the building do not try to heal one another before the crusade. In fact, they choose to wait on lines for hours to get inside of the building in hopes that Benny Hinn or some sort of power goes over them that will heal them.
